HOW IS A TENANT REPRESENTATIVE COMPENSATED?

0

Tenant representatives are compensated by the landlord. The landlord pays their listing agent a fee and the listing agent shares that fee with the tenant representative. If you don’t have representation, the landlord will pay the entire fee to the listing agent, whose job and fiduciary obligations are to get the best possible terms for his principal — the landlord. A tenant representative’s job and fiduciary obligation are to get the best possible terms for the client, aka tenant.
